What You’ll Need
Gather the following ingredients for your Healthy Peach Cobbler:
For the Peaches
- 4 cups fresh peaches, sliced
For the Topping
- 1 cup rolled oats
- 1/2 cup almond flour
- 1/4 cup coconut sugar
- 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
- 1/4 teaspoon nutmeg
- 2 tablespoons coconut oil, melted
For the Wet Ingredients
- 1 cup almond milk
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 tablespoon lemon juice
Substitute coconut sugar with regular sugar if needed.
Substitutions & Swaps
- Almond flour can be swapped for whole wheat flour.
- Coconut oil works with unsalted butter.
- Almond milk is replaceable with any milk of choice.
- Fresh peaches can be substituted with frozen ones.
How to Make It
Prepare this delightful cobbler in a few easy steps.
Preheat
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a baking dish to prevent sticking.
Combine Peaches
In a bowl, combine sliced peaches with lemon juice and set aside. This step brightens up the flavor of the peaches.
Mix Dry Ingredients
In another bowl, mix oats, almond flour, coconut sugar, cinnamon, and nutmeg until well combined.
Add Wet Ingredients
Add melted coconut oil, almond milk, and vanilla extract to the dry ingredients, stirring to combine thoroughly.
Layer Peaches
Layer the peaches in the greased baking dish and top with the oat mixture, spreading it evenly for a consistent texture.
Bake
Bake for 30-35 minutes, or until the top is golden and the peaches are bubbly. Keep an eye on it to achieve that perfect golden color.
Cool
Allow to cool slightly before serving, enabling the flavors to set and making it easier to serve.
How to Store It
Fridge: store in an airtight container for up to 5 days.
Freezer: yes, for up to 3 months, but texture may change.
Reheat: microwave for 30-60 seconds or warm in the oven at 350°F for 10 minutes.
Tips for Best Results
- Use ripe peaches for the sweetest flavor.
- Let the cobbler cool slightly before serving to enhance the texture.
- Drizzle with honey or serve with yogurt for added creaminess.
- Experiment with spices, adding nutmeg or ginger for extra warmth.
